Transaction 2aab75236cdb485c2f337f3415773a2e70ae45958b5bd00f6ff13636dae5fc80
1 Input
1 Output
-
2aab75236cdb485c2f337f3415773a2e70ae45958b5bd00f6ff13636dae5fc80:0
- value
- 38699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ab09eb22777a469be7058defb357b994300314c6 OP_EQUAL
- address
- 3HHPMViHL16dGEgz9AfeMCz8kkuLq4GVxR